Everyone who has moved know the costs can quickly add up, which can add to the stress of moving. One of the best ways to save money is to get your moving boxes FREE. Yes, it can be done. I just looked on U-Hauls website and to get 100 boxes and supplies it was over $500! That's not chump change in my book. So, if you're moving or have clients moving check out these resources.
Craigslist - Post a free Wanted ad, people are always moving and needing to get rid of their boxes.
Once again, on Craigslist, look under the Free section for people giving away moving boxes.
Yahoo has FreeCycle groups all over the country, actually 4,604 groups. The point of FreeCycle is to keep things out of the landfills by recycling. Post a free Wanted request. While you're there post a free Offer request to give other people a chance to get the things you don't want to move. On FreeCycle, no money changes hands. It's FREE. It's a great way to recycle.
Go to your local recycle center and get the boxes there that others are getting rid of.

Go to your local liquor stores, drug and grocery stores. They always have boxes. Ask the store manager what day they get deliveries and if you can have the boxes.
Ask friends that have recently moved to pass on their moving boxes to you.
Once you have used your boxes, pass them on to someone else. It's good for the environment and everyone's wallet!
